  • Abstract
    Macromodels which allow a complete simulation of the power supply including switching transients to reduce the simulation time costs are introduced. These macromodels have been implemented using advanced features of PSPICE. These features include its mixed analog/digital and analog behavioral modeling capabilities. Some simulations are presented to highlight the advantages of both approaches
